Lord of Misrule was in the Halloween collection that Lush put out in 2014. There are expiry dates to these things...I better start using all of mine up.

This bath bomb turned my bath water into a nice mix of green and deep pink colour, with a slight shimmer to it as well. 








Here is what the website had to say about it:

"Inspired by the ruler of the Pagan Feast of Fools, Lord of Misrule brings mischievous revelry to the tub with a spicy herbal blend of patchouli and black pepper oil. As it slowly froths in the water, hypnotic swirling silver luster is released and the deep green exterior soon gives way to a rich, wine-colored center. Just like at the Feast of Fools, when the wine begins flowing, the revelry really begins! Popping candies fizz and crackle, creating a world of magic and mischief right before your eyes".


Here's to hoping they bring this bath bomb back for fall this year, I definitely enjoyed this one! If you aren't in the mood for something floral, or super girly - this bath bomb scent is the one for you!
